I've switched laptops and am having an issue on my new one that I can't figure out. The transforms are behaving inproperly. When I shift-drag a single axis, the results are incorrect. I've tried this several times on different primitives. This is what happens:
translate:
x controls z
y controls x
z controls x
rotate:
x controls x (correct)
y controls x
z controls y
scale:
x controls x (correct)
y controls x
z controls z (correct)
In the Transform window, numeric entries/ rolling the button are sometimes correct, sometimes incorrect.

In case anyone else runs into this, it is a graphics problem related to automatic updates. We were having this problem on one Dell laptop and a black dome issue on another. There was a handful of steps that needed to be done (someone else did this, so I can't tell you what, exactly), but since we turned all updates to manual, the problem has been resolved.
